* Wed Oct 06 2010 alexandre@exatati.com.br
- Update to 0.7.5:
  * Python 3.x is now fully supported. The paint is still drying on this so
    please help with testing and raise bug tickets when you find any issues!
  * Moved code hosting to github. All history ported thanks to the most
    excellent tool, svn2git (http://github.com/nirvdrum/svn2git).
  * All netaddr objects now use approx. 65% less memory due to the use of
    __slots__ in classes throughout the codebase. Thanks to Stefan Nordhausen
  and his Python guru for this suggestion!
  * Applied many optimisations and speedups throughout the codebase.
  * Fixed the behaviour of the IPNetwork constructor so it now behaves in
    a much more sensible and expected way (i.e. no longer uses inet_aton
    semantics which is just plain odd for network addresses).
  * One minor change to behaviour in this version is that the .value property
    on IPAddress and IPNetwork objects no longer support assignment using a
    string IP address. Only integer value assignments are now valid. The impact
    of this change should be minimal for the majority of users.

* Fri Sep 25 2015 michael@stroeder.com
- update to 0.7.18:
  * cidr_merge() algorithm is now O(n) and much faster.
  * nmap target specification now fully supported including IPv4 CIDR
    prefixes and IPv6 addresses.
    FIXED Issue 100: https://github.com/drkjam/netaddr/issues/100
  - nmap.py - CIDR targets
    FIXED Issue 112: https://github.com/drkjam/netaddr/issues/112
  - Observation: netaddr slower under pypy
  * Fixed a regression with valid_mac due to shadow import in the
    netaddr module.
    FIXED Issue 114: https://github.com/drkjam/netaddr/issues/114
  - netaddr.valid_mac('00-B0-D0-86-BB-F7')==False for 0.7.16 but True for 0.7.15
  * IPv4 networks with /31 and /32 netmasks are now treated according to
    RFC 3021. Thanks to kalombos and braaen.

* Mon May 12 2014 hpj@urpla.net
- Update to 0.7.11:
  * Performance of IPSet increased dramatically, implemented by
    Stefan Nordhausen and Martijn van Oosterhout. As a side effect,
    IPSet(IPNetwork("10.0.0.0/8")) is now as fast as you'd expect.
  * Various performance improvements all over the place.
  * netaddr is now hosted on PyPI and can be installed via pip.
  * Doing "10.0.0.42" in IPNetwork("10.0.0.0/24") works now.
  * IPSet has two new methods: iscontiguous() and iprange(), thanks to Louis des Landes.
  * Re-added the IPAddress.netmask_bits() method that was accidently removed.
  * Networks 128.0.0.0/16, 191.255.0.0/16, and 223.255.255.0/24 are not marked as
    reserved IPv4 addresses any more. Thanks to marnickv for pointing that out.
  * Various bug fixes contributed by Wilfred Hughes, 2*yo and Adam Goodman.
